One of our most unique 1 bedroom 1 bathroom log cabins, you're sure to remember that # 69 is a real treat. Upon entering, on the bottom level, you're in for quite a surprise. This cabin was built around a tree!!! Yes, a tree goes from the bottom level, in the middle of your dining area, all the way up through the top level, right past the foot of your bed. Ground level consists of an incredibly well thought out style of kitchen and dining area, with mason jars as light covers, and an old washtub sink equipped with a hand pump water spout and all! Upstairs, on one side you'll find a cozy loveseat and TV with fireplace in your sitting area, and your bedroom with a queen sized bed and Jacuzzi on the other. Staying in this cabin makes for a splendid vacation you'll always remember. Our resort area swimming pool and clubhouse is within walking distance for those hot summer days. Area restaurants and attractions are all just minutes away by car.

About the area
Pigeon Forge
Located in Pigeon Forge, this cabin is near theme parks and in the mountains. Dolly Parton's Stampede Dinner Attraction and Titanic Museum are cultural highlights, and some of the area's popular attractions include Dollywood and Dollywood's Splash Country. Check out an event or a game at The Ripken Experience - Pigeon Forge, and consider making time for Ripley's Aquarium of the Smokies, a top attraction not to be missed. Make sure you get close to the area's animals with activities such as game walks and birdwatching.
